我是一名初学者。我听说过很多关于 Ubuntu 的事情,所以我想知道它是否是最适合我的操作系统。我将使用它来学习嵌入式 Linux 和用 C 语言编程微控制器。我可以使用 Ubuntu 吗?请给我一些建议。
答案1
在工作站上运行嵌入式发行版毫无意义,在嵌入式设备上运行工作站发行版也毫无意义。运行 Ubuntu 桌面的 PC 非常适合用作编程微控制器的工作站。
Ubuntu 软件中心有大量软件可供您使用,例如 Arduino IDE(集成开发环境)或可以帮助您进行电路仿真和/或电路板设计的程序。我更喜欢使用 synaptic 查看可用的软件包。如果您在网上找到一些无法通过软件中心或 synaptic 获得但可以在 linux 上运行的东西,那么它通常很容易安装。
答案2
Ubuntu 系统要求是:
700 MHz 处理器(大约 Intel Celeron 或更高配置) 512 MiB RAM(系统内存) 5 GB 硬盘空间(或 USB 记忆棒、存储卡或外部驱动器,但请参阅 LiveCD 了解替代方法) VGA,支持 1024x768 屏幕分辨率 CD/DVD 驱动器或用于安装程序介质的 USB 端口
https://help.ubuntu.com/community/Installation/SystemRequirements
您需要将这些要求与您选择的平台进行比较。Raspberry Pi 将运行 Fedora,而 Fedora 是其平台的理想选择,因为它的系统要求较低(比 ubuntu 低)。
如果您想要使用 Arduino 之类的东西,Arduino 提供了一个独立的脚本程序/编译器(可在 Ubuntu 操作系统上运行)。
简短的回答是这样的:这取决于硬件。